Abstract

The utility model relates to a paddle mounting angle adjustable structure which is capable of effectively solving the problem of paddle angle adjustment, meeting the stirring requirements of material parameters changed in a certain range, improving the using efficiency of stirrers and lowering the production cost. The paddle mounting angle adjustable structure adopts the technical scheme that the paddle mounting angle adjustable structure comprises paddles, paddle bottom plates, pressing plates and stirring shafts, wherein paddle wheel hubs are arranged on the stirring shafts, the paddle roots of the stirring paddles are welded together with the paddle bottom plates, and the pressing plates are fixed in the paddle wheel hubs, so that a mounting angle adjusting structure of the stirring paddles rotating in the paddle wheel hubs clockwise or anticlockwise is formed, therefore, the adjustability of paddle mounting angles is realized. The paddle mounting angle adjustable structure is convenient to process, mount, dismount and use; and the paddle angles can be adjusted, the use efficiency of stirrers is improved, and good economic and social benefits are achieved.

Background technology
Present propeller-blade, particularly the CBY blade is widely used in industries such as metallurgy, chemical industry, medicine, the field that be used for, the mixing of low-viscosity fluid, extraction, emulsification, solid suspends dissolving.Blade adopts bolt to connect with the journal stirrup that is connected through being welded on the shaft of shaft.For the mixing plant that has put into production use, in general agitator can only be directed against this kind material, with fixed rotating speed, use under the angle in fixed installation.When parameter of materials changes within the specific limits to some extent; Former agitator possibly just satisfy not the stirring requirement; Need to design again, if new departure adjustment is little, in the time of only need regulating stirring intensity by the size of blade angle according to new argument; Former welding manner has just influenced the enforcement of this scheme, thereby has influenced the service efficiency of former blade.This requires to reduce production costs, improve the product benefit to present social economy high speed development and has brought very big influence; So how to develop a kind of the need and makes again, satisfy the frame mode that has the parameter of materials demand now and become the technical issues that need to address through changing former blade angle.

The specific embodiment
Elaborate below in conjunction with the specific embodiment of accompanying drawing to the utility model.
By Fig. 1, shown in 2; The utility model comprises blade, blade base plate, pressing plate and shaft; Blade wheel hub 2 is housed on the shaft 1, and the blade root of stirrer paddle 7 and blade base plate 3 weld together, and are fixed in the blade wheel hub 2 by pressing plate 4; Constitute stirrer paddle in blade wheel hub 2 clockwise or the structure of the adjusting setting angle that rotates counterclockwise, realize the controllability of wing setting angle degree.
For easy to maintenance and assurance result of use, described pressing plate 4 is fixed on the blade wheel hub 2 by bolt 5 and spring shim 6; Described stirrer paddle 7 is the CBY blade, is that straight leaf, curved leaf, oblique leaf etc. are any type of a kind of.
The utility model is in practical implementation, and the blade wheel hub is contained on the shaft perisporium, utilizes key and is bolted to stirrer paddle and the welding of blade base plate on the shaft; To weld good blade base plate then and pack in the wheel hub, and cover pressing plate, and use bolt, this structure has just realized the controllability of wing setting angle degree.
The utility model basic principle is following: the power P=N of agitator pρ N 3d 5, N p=KRe DFr qF (d/D, b/D, H/D, θ ... ..), in the formula: ρ material density, N speed of agitator, d paddle diameter, b blade width, D tank diameter, K equation coefficient, θ stirrer paddle setting angle.In general, when blade angle θ diminishes, N pReduce the also corresponding reduction of power P.When parameter of materials changes; For the mixing plant that has come into operation; Can be constant change the intensity of agitator under the situation of (being that power P, rotational speed N, oar footpath d remain unchanged) through adjustment CBY blade angle in the power allowed band, reach new stirring requirement at motor, constant, the former agitator of reductor.Stirring intensity becomes big when angle increases, and stirring intensity weakened when angle reduced, and can adjust the setting angle θ of blade as required, satisfies the demand of existing parameter of materials power of agitator, thereby improves the service efficiency of agitator.
The utility model provides a kind of adjustable angle joint formula agitator; Be when original stirring cell body parameter of materials changes; Can be through changing the syndeton of CBY blade and shaft, according to the setting angle of design demand adjustment blade, under the prerequisite of guaranteeing agitator power, the requirement of shaft strength and stiffness; Change mixing effect, improve the service efficiency of CBY blade.This stirrer paddle both can have been realized the parameter of materials of the same race interior application of excursion to some extent; Also can be implemented in the exchange between different material in the parameter of materials certain limit; Therefore the adjustable structure of novel setting angle can be applicable to all kinds of dashers; Also can in different industry fields, promote, can practice thrift cost largely, realize good economic benefit and social benefit.
